Our verdict is Uncertain significance. The variant received 2 ACMG points: 2P and 0B. PM2

The NM_015056.3(RRP1B):​c.400C>G​(p.Arg134Gly) variant causes a missense change involving the alteration of a non-conserved nucleotide. The variant allele was found at a frequency of 0.00000207 in 1,450,684 control chromosomes in the GnomAD database, with no homozygous occurrence. Variant has been reported in ClinVar as Uncertain significance (★). Another variant affecting the same amino acid position, but resulting in a different missense (i.e. R134Q) has been classified as Uncertain significance.

RRP1B (HGNC:23818): (ribosomal RNA processing 1B) Enables transcription coactivator activity. Involved in several processes, including cellular response to virus; positive regulation by host of viral transcription; and positive regulation of transcription by RNA polymerase II. Located in chromosome; granular component; and nucleoplasm. [provided by Alliance of Genome Resources, Apr 2022]

The c.400C>G (p.R134G) alteration is located in exon 5 (coding exon 5) of the RRP1B gene. This alteration results from a C to G substitution at nucleotide position 400, causing the arginine (R) at amino acid position 134 to be replaced by a glycine (G). Based on insufficient or conflicting evidence, the clinical significance of this alteration remains unclear. -
